Former Weight Watchers Plan
The term “Weight Watchers” – a trademark – literally means “weight monitoring.” Weight Watchers clubs, appeared first in the United States, were then scattered throughout the world. Before being based on points, the Weight Watchers plan included a breakdown by parts.
The Weight Watchers diet plans to never skip a meal. At this absolute principle then added dietary patterns that we will detail later. It is strongly advised to consult a doctor before starting this program and to undergo regular checks during treatment (conducted by the Weight Watchers Company itself in the U.S.). Particular care should be taken if it is during pregnancy.
This food program lasts 16 weeks and theoretically leads to a weight loss of at least 5 kg.
The low-calorie diet
The low-calorie diet meets the basic principle of weight loss: reducing energy intake, particularly by controlling the quantities of sugar and fat ingested in order to force the body to dip into its reserves. However, it should not lead to deficiencies and requires much discipline.
Principle: The principle of low-calorie diet is simple: it reduces energy intake, especially fats and sugars faster, while maintaining a wide variety of food. According to the goal of calorie limit, it is more or less strict in the choice of food. It comes with simple rules: do not snack between meals, avoiding sugary drinks, pay attention to seasonings and sauces …
The low-calorie Critique: The low-calorie diet is effective but requires discipline. If your goal of weight loss is important (more than 5 pounds), better to get help from a dietitian or doctor. In addition to his aid and advice, it will bring you an essential psychological support. The duration of the plan depends on how many pounds to lose and rigorous monitoring. The resumption of a normal diet should be gradual, and good eating habits must be kept. Otherwise, weight regain is guaranteed! Finally, increase your physical activity can help.
